33,641 is a prime number. Like all primes greater than two, it is odd and has no factors apart from itself and one.

Names of 33641

  • Cardinal: 33641 can be written as Thirty-three thousand, six hundred forty-one.

Scientific notation

  • Scientific notation: 3.3641 × 104

Factors of 33641

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 1
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 1
  • Sum of prime factors: 33641

Divisors of 33641

  • Number of divisors d(n): 2
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 33642
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1
  • 33641 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 33640

Bases of 33641

  • Binary: 10000011011010012
  • Hexadecimal: 0x8369
  • Base-36: PYH

Squares and roots of 33641

  • 33641 squared (336412) is 1131716881
  • 33641 cubed (336413) is 38072087593721
  • The square root of 33641 is 183.4148303709
  • The cube root of 33641 is 32.2816926995
